feat(gmw): moderation explainability + semantic message search

- Persist structured verdict (flags/severity/confidence/evidence) on
  moderation_actions so the public web can show WHY a message was moderated.
- Add a persistent Qdrant archive collection (gmw_message_archive); embed
  every captured message at capture time (fire-and-forget, best-effort).
- Public semantic search over the archive (backend oRPC + FE toggle on the
  messages view). Both features are read-only/public and fully automatic.

Migration: 0015_add_moderation_explainability.sql

// ─── Archive variants (collection-aware, for persistent message search) ───
// These mirror the cache functions but take an explicit collection name so the
// semantic-search archive (gmw_message_archive) can live alongside the
// TTL-bounded automod cache without disturbing it.
/** Ensure an arbitrary collection exists with the right vector size. */
export async function ensureQdrantCollectionV2(
name: string,
vectorSize: number,
): Promise<boolean> {
try {
let existing: {
result?: { config?: { params?: { vectors?: { size?: number } } } };
} | null = null;
try {
existing = (await request("GET", `/collections/${name}`)) as {
result?: { config?: { params?: { vectors?: { size?: number } } } };
} | null;
} catch (error) {
if (!(error instanceof Error) || !error.message.includes("-> 404")) {
throw error;
}
}
const size = existing?.result?.config?.params?.vectors?.size;
if (size === vectorSize) return true;
if (size !== undefined && size !== vectorSize) {
log.warn(
{ collection: name, oldSize: size, newSize: vectorSize },
"Qdrant archive collection vector size changed — recreating collection",
);
await request("DELETE", `/collections/${name}`);
}
await request("PUT", `/collections/${name}`, {
vectors: { size: vectorSize, distance: "Cosine" },
});
return true;
} catch (error) {
log.error(
{
error: error instanceof Error ? error.message : String(error),
collection: name,
},
"Failed to ensure Qdrant archive collection",
);
return false;
}
}
